User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.9.1b4) Gecko/20090423 Firefox/3.5b4 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.9.1b4) Gecko/20090423 Firefox/3.5b4 This is pretty similar to bug 490530 and 456382, but the later is closed and the former wants something different, so I'm filing a new bug. In 3.0 if you close the last tab it's replaced with a :blank window. This is very useful behavior, largely for the reasons mentioned in commetns 30 and 31 in 456382. But to re-iterate, I pretty much never want to close my browser completely, but I *do* often want to close the page I'm looking at. Either I'm done with it, or it it has some audio, or whatever. I think it's clear that closing the last tab shouldn't make the browser exit, but the option to close that tab is still nonetheless useful. This was the behavior in FF3.0 and I believe it to be the correct behavior.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Open browser 2. Go to webpage 3. Try to close tab Actual Results: Can't close tab Expected Results: Can close tab
I'm adding a "blocking-3.5" tag because I consider this a regression. Clearly if the developers don't agree then it can be changed.
